Given the parameters you specify I would say the P-47 because of its survivability.  It obviously was a good enough match for the German fighters--especially those occupied with Bombers.  After that I'd say P-38 because of the twin engines to get you home if one gets hit (P-51 engine gets hit, you likely going down).

If it was simply skinning Heinz off of the butts of some fat old bombers, there isn't a dog in the bunch.  It's the post escort part of your question that makes me say Jug.

One wonders how many Spit-escorted missions there would have been if they could have increased the range without affecting performance adversely.  US pilots who flew Spits rarely, if ever, got over the planes.  Obviously it was an amazing aircraft in a pissing contest, but from what I have read I would rather strafe in a Jug.  

One also wonders if the Jug had the range of the P-51 if the Pony would ever have become the marvel it is perceived as having been.  I mean, some might argue that the P-47 shouldered the toughest part of the fight against the better German pilots and came out on top.  Its record is pretty glowing.

Hi Whitehawk,

>Which would you rather be flying in a escort roll?  

P-51. It's the only one of the three you named that has full high Mach manoeuvrability. And its laminar flow profile means that it gains turn rate at medium to high altitude, too.

The P-47 may have the survivability, but we haven't talked about susceptibility yet. It means that a bigger, less manoeuvrable target will be hit more often ... :-)

The P-38 is Mach limited and has a poor search view, and its thick chord wings make it lose turn rate at operational altitudes. It's not as fast as the P-51 down low, and if coming home alive is a priority, I'd prefer the faster plane.
